Understanding Chiropractic Radiology

Chiropractic Radiology in Chiropractor—Savannah

Chiropractic Radiology is a branch of chiropractic care that focuses on using medical imaging to diagnose conditions affecting the spine, joints. And muscles. Unlike general radiology, which covers all parts of the body, Chiropractic Radiology specializes in the musculoskeletal system—the bones, muscles. And connective tissues that support movement. Chiropractors or chiropractic radiologists use tools like X-rays, MRI (magnetic resonance imaging). And CT (computed tomography) scans to get detailed pictures of these areas.

These images help chiropractors see problems that might not be visible during a physical exam. For example, an X-ray can show a misaligned vertebra, a fracture. Or signs of arthritis. An MRI can reveal issues with soft tissues, such as herniated discs or pinched nerves. By understanding what these images show, chiropractors can create treatment plans that are safer and more targeted to the patient’s needs. Chiropractic Radiology is not used for every patient. But it becomes important when a chiropractor needs more information to diagnose a condition or rule out serious problems.

How Chiropractic Radiology Works?

Chiropractic Radiology works by capturing images of the body’s internal structures and interpreting them to guide treatment. The process usually starts with a chiropractor deciding that imaging is needed, often because a patient has persistent pain, a history of injury. Or symptoms that suggest a deeper issue. The patient is then referred for an imaging test, such as an X-ray, which takes just a few minutes and involves minimal radiation exposure. For more detailed images, an MRI or CT scan might be used, which can take longer but provide clearer views of soft tissues or complex structures.

Many projects start with Once the images are taken, a chiropractic radiologist—a chiropractor with advanced training in reading medical images—reviews them. This specialist looks for signs of misalignments, fractures, degeneration. Or other abnormalities that could explain the patient’s symptoms. The findings are then shared with the treating chiropractor, who uses this information to decide on the best course of action, such as spinal adjustments, physical therapy. Or lifestyle recommendations. In some cases, the images might also help rule out conditions that require medical or surgical care, ensuring the patient gets the right type of help.

Chiropractic Radiology is not just about taking pictures, it’s about making sense of them. The images themselves don’t diagnose a problem; it’s the trained eye of the chiropractic radiologist that turns those pictures into useful information. This process helps chiropractors avoid guesswork and focus on the root cause of a patient’s pain or dysfunction.

Why Chiropractic Radiology Matters?

Chiropractic Radiology matters because it helps chiropractors make informed decisions about a patient’s care. Without imaging, chiropractors rely solely on physical exams, which can miss hidden problems like tiny fractures, early-stage arthritis. Or disc herniations. Imaging provides a clearer picture of what’s happening inside the body, which can lead to more accurate diagnoses and better outcomes. For example, an X-ray might reveal that a patient’s chronic back pain is caused by a misaligned vertebra, allowing the chiropractor to target that area with adjustments.

Another reason Chiropractic Radiology is important is safety. Some conditions, like severe osteoporosis or spinal infections, can make certain chiropractic treatments risky. Imaging helps chiropractors identify these issues before starting treatment, reducing the chance of complications. It also helps track progress over time, such as monitoring how a patient’s spine responds to adjustments or therapy. While imaging isn’t needed for every patient, it becomes a valuable tool when symptoms are unclear or don’t improve with standard care.

When Chiropractic Radiology Matters Most?

Chiropractic Radiology matters most in situations where a patient’s symptoms are persistent, severe. Or unusual. For example, if someone has back pain that doesn’t improve after several weeks of treatment, imaging can help identify whether there’s an underlying issue, such as a herniated disc or spinal stenosis. It’s also important for patients with a history of trauma, like a car accident or fall, where imaging can check for fractures or other injuries that might not be obvious during a physical exam.

Another key time for Chiropractic Radiology is when a chiropractor suspects a condition that requires medical or surgical care. For instance, imaging can help rule out serious problems like tumors, infections. Or nerve compression that might need a different type of treatment. It’s also useful for older adults or people with chronic conditions like arthritis, where imaging can show the extent of joint damage and guide gentler treatment options. In Savannah, GA, where chiropractors often see patients with work-related injuries or sports-related strains, Chiropractic Radiology can help ensure these patients get the right care for their specific needs.

Finally, Chiropractic Radiology is valuable when a patient’s symptoms don’t match the usual patterns. For example, if someone has leg pain but no obvious spine issues, an MRI might reveal a pinched nerve in the lower back that’s causing the problem. By using imaging wisely, chiropractors can avoid unnecessary treatments and focus on what’s truly helping the patient heal.
